=head1 NAME
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session - Session manager for handling child processes.
=head1 SYNOPSIS
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session;
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ess qw(process);
my $session = process()->session; # or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session->singleton
$session->enable; # Modifies your SIG_CHLD
$session->on(collected => sub { warn "Process ".(shift->pid)." collected! "});
$session->on(collected_orphan => sub { warn "Orphan process collected! "});
$session->enable_subreaper(); # Mark the current process as subreaper
$session->disable_subreaper(); # Disable subreaper
$session->reset(); # Resets events and clear the process tables
$session->clean(); # Stop all processes that result as running and reset

=head1 EVENTS
L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session> inherits all events from L<Mojo::EventEmitter> and can emit
the following new ones.
=head2 SIG_CHLD
$session->on(SIG_CHLD => sub {
my ($self) = @_;
...
});
Emitted when we receive SIG_CHLD.
=head2 collected
$session->on(collected => sub {
my ($self, $process) = @_;
...
});
Emitted when child process is collected and it's return status is available.
=head2 protect
$session->on(protect => sub {
my ($self, $detail) = @_;
my ($cb, $signal) = @$detail;
...
});
Emitted when protected callbacks are fired.
=head2 collected_orphan
$session->on(collected_orphan => sub {
my ($self, $process) = @_;
$process->pid;
$process->exit_status;
...
});
Emitted when child process is collected and it's exit status is available.
Note: here are collected processes that weren't created with L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ess>.
=head2 register
$session->on(register => sub {
my ($self, $process) = @_;
$process->pid;
$process->exit_status;
...
});
Emitted when a process is registering to a session.
=head1 ATTRIBUTES
L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session> inherits all attributes from L<Mojo::EventEmitter> and implements
the following new ones.
=head2 subreaper
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
session->enable_subreaper;
my $process =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ess->new(code => sub { print "Hello ".$_[1] }, args => "User" );
$process->start();
$process->on( stop => sub { shift()->disable_subreaper } );
$process->stop();
# The process will print "Hello User"
Mark the current process (not the child) as subreaper on start.
It's on invoker behalf to disable subreaper when process stops, as it marks the current process and not the
child.
=head2 collect_status
Defaults to C<1>, If enabled it will automatically collect the status of the children process.
Disable it in case you want to manage your process child directly, and do not want to rely on
automatic collect status. If you won't overwrite your C<SIGCHLD> handler,
the C<SIG_CHLD> event will be still emitted.

=head1 METHODS
L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session> inherits all methods from L<Mojo::EventEmitter> and implements
the following new ones.
=head2 enable()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
session->enable();
Sets the SIG_CHLD handler.
=head2 disable()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
session->disable();
Disables the SIG_CHLD handler and reset with the previous one.
=head2 enable_subreaper()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ess qw(process);
my $p = process()->enable_subreaper;
# or
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
session->enable_subreaper;
Mark the current process (not the child) as subreaper.
This is used typically if you want to mark further children as subreapers inside other forks.
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$master_p = process(
sub {
my $p = shift;
$p->enable_subreaper;
process(sub { sleep 4; exit 1 })->start();
process(
sub {
sleep 4;
process(sub { sleep 1; })->start();
})->start();
process(sub { sleep 4; exit 0 })->start();
process(sub { sleep 4; die })->start();
my $manager
= process(sub { sleep 2 })->subreaper(1)->start();
sleep 1 for (0 .. 10);
$manager->stop;
return session->all->size;
});
$master_p->subreaper(1);
$master_p->on(collect_status => sub { $status++ });
$master_p->on(stop => sub { shift()->disable_subreaper });
$master_p->start();
session->all->size();
....
=head2 disable_subreaper()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ess qw(process);
my $p = process()->disable_subreaper;
Unset the current process as subreaper.
=head2 prctl()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ess qw(process);
my $p = process();
$p->prctl($option, $arg2, $arg3, $arg4, $arg5);
Internal function to execute and wrap the prctl syscall, accepts the same arguments as prctl.
=head2 reset()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ess qw(session);
session->reset;
Wipe the process tables.
=head2 clean()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ess qw(session);
session->clean;
Wipe the process tables, but before attempt to stop running procesess.
=head2 all()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$collection = session->all;
$collection->size;
Returns a L<Mojo::Collection> of L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ess> that belongs to a session.
=head2 all_orphans()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$collection = session->all_orphans;
$collection->size;
Returns a L<Mojo::Collection> of L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ess> of orphaned processes that belongs to a session.
They are automatically turned into a L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ess>, also if processes were created by C<fork()>.
=head2 all_processes()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$collection = session->all_processes;
$collection->size;
Returns a L<Mojo::Collection> of all L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ess> known processes that belongs to a session.
=head2 contains()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$collection = session->contains(13443);
$collection->size;
Returns true if the pid is contained in any of the process tables.
=head2 resolve()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$process = session->resolve(12233);
Returns the L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ess> process identified by its pid if belongs to the process table.
=head2 orphan()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$process = session->orphan(12233);
Returns the L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ess> process identified by its pid if belongs to the process table of unknown processes.
=head2 register()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$process = session->register('pid' =>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ess->new);
Register the L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ess> process to the session.
=head2 unregister()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$process = session->unregister(123342);
Unregister the corresponding L<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ess> with the given pid.
=head2 collect()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
my $process = session->collect(123342 => 0 => undef);
Collect the status for the given pid.
=head2 protect()
use Mojo::IOLoop::ReadWriteProcess::Session qw(session);
use POSIX;
my $return = session->protect(sub { print "Hello World\n" });
session->protect(sub { print "Hello World\n" } => SIGTERM);
Try to protect the execution of the callback from signal interrupts.

=head1 DEBUGGING
You can set the MOJO_EVENTEMITTER_DEBUG environment variable to get some advanced diagnostics information printed to STDERR.
MOJO_EVENTEMITTER_DEBUG=1
Also, you can set MOJO_PROCESS_DEBUG environment variable to get diagnostics about the process execution.
MOJO_PROCESS_DEBUG=1
